以太坊價格 以太坊價格
Ctrl+D 以太坊價格
ads

ARB:Layer2:Rollups詳細解讀-ODAILY

Author:

Time:1900/1/1 0:00:00

背景介紹

從比特幣創世開始,一直到以太坊網絡中CryptoKitties游戲的出現。主流公鏈項目最被人詬病的地方就是低下的TPS。以太坊15左右的TPS完全無法給大多數應用提供實時穩定的支持,這與當前互聯網行業動輒上萬TPS的業務形成了鮮明的對比。甚至有很多人因此覺得公鏈將長期處于“不可用”狀態。然而,公鏈愛好者不會因為困難而停下腳步。

主流方案對比

對于以太坊而言,過去幾年內關于以太坊擴容的方案如雨后春筍般涌出,形成了百家爭鳴的態勢。其主流的方案如下所示:

1.鏈上擴容:

分片技術:分片一詞本來源于數據庫的術語,表示將大型數據庫分割為很多更小的、更易管理的部分,從而能夠實現更加高效的交互。

區塊鏈分片是指對區塊鏈網絡進行分片,從而增加其擴展性。根據最新的以太坊2.0規范,以太坊區塊鏈會被分為1024個分片鏈,這也意味著以太坊的TPS將提高1000倍以上。但目前Sharding方案仍然在跨分片通信、欺詐識別、隨機分配與選舉安全性等方面存在不足。

數據:LayerZero已跨鏈傳遞超5000萬條信息:7月26日消息,據官方數據顯示,跨鏈互操作性協議LayerZero已在不同鏈間傳遞超5000萬條信息。[2023/7/26 15:58:46]

2.鏈下擴容:

狀態通道:指代用于執行交易和其他狀態更新的“鏈下”技術。

但是,一個狀態通道內發生的事務仍保持了很高的安全性和不可更改性。如果出現任何問題,我們仍然可以回溯到鏈上交易中確定的穩定版本。

側鏈技術:側鏈是平行于主鏈的一條鏈,由側鏈上的驗證者把一條鏈的最新狀態提交給主鏈上的智能合約,這樣持續推進的一類系統。側鏈通常使用PoA(Proof-of-Authority)、PoS(ProofofStake)等高效的共識算法。它的優勢在于代碼和數據與主鏈獨立,不會增加主鏈的負擔,缺陷在于它的安全性弱、不夠中心化,無法提供審查抗性、終局性和資金所有權保證。

OKX Ventures戰略投資Layer1公鏈Sei Network:4月12日消息,據官方消息,OKX Ventures 宣布戰略投資 Layer1 公鏈 Sei Network。Sei Network 是第一個并行化 Cosmos 鏈,允許同時處理獨立事務,提高整體吞吐量和延遲,專為交易設計。

據 OKX Ventures 創始人 Dora 表示,OKX Ventures 長期堅定的擁抱去中心化發展的未來,堅持投資長期結構性價值,加注具有創新技術的 Layer1 潛力項目。此次投資 Sei Network,我們將提供資金、服務、資源等全方位的支持,和創業者共同成長,并引入 OKX 生態來賦能項目方,幫助其構建更加去中心化和高效的金融基礎設施。[2023/4/12 13:59:27]

Rollup技術:顧名思義,就是把一堆交易卷起來匯總成一個交易,所有接收到這個交易的節點只去驗證執行結果,而不會驗證邏輯。因此Rollup交易所需Gas費會遠小于交易Gas費總和,TPS也增加了。

主流的Rollup技術可以分為兩類:

Klaytn公布BUIDL the Future黑客松Klaytn賽道獲獎項目:3月2日消息,韓國區塊鏈平臺Klaytn發文介紹Coinbase Cloud主辦的BUIDL the Future黑客松Klaytn賽道的獲獎項目者,分別為:冠軍項目Web3眾籌平臺Wanna、第一名NFT游戲化平臺 Encryp、第二名NFT資產管理平臺 GameFolio。[2023/3/2 12:38:36]

ZkRollup:基于零知識證明的Layer2擴容方案,采用有效性驗證方法(VP),默認所有交易都是不誠實的,只有通過有效性驗證才會被接受。ZkRollup在鏈下進行復雜的計算和證明的生成,鏈上進行證明的校驗并存儲部分數據保證數據可用性。

OptimisticRollup:樂觀的Rollup協議,采用欺詐證明方法,即對鏈上發布的所有Rollup區塊都保持樂觀態度并假設其有效,它僅在欺詐發生的情況下提供證據。

樂觀Rollup的優勢在于能使得原生Layer1上的solidity合約可以無縫移植到Layer2,從而最大程度提升了技術人員的研發體驗,目前主流方案包括Optimism和Arbitrum。

Offchain Labs和Matter Labs計劃為Layer 2網絡集成抗MEV機制:以太坊擴容團隊Matter Labs首席執行官Alex Gluchowski和Offchain Labs首席技術官Harry Kalodner都表示將集成可以對抗MEV(礦工可提取價值)的方案。Offchain Labs表示在探索一種相對比較新穎的方案,可能不會在剛開始的時候提供,其聯合創始人和首席執行官Steven Goldfeder,同樣也是MEV學術論文的作者之一,最近聯合發表了一種全新的共識算法論文《Order-Fairness for Byzantine Consensus》,將排序這件事去中心化。Matter Labs表示將通過零知識證明和VDF(可驗證延遲函數)技術隱藏交易內容,徹底避免MEV。[2020/12/7 14:29:20]

Plasma方案:通過智能合約和Merkel樹建立子鏈,每個子鏈都是一個可定制的智能合約,子鏈共存并獨立運行,從而大幅降低主鏈的TPS壓力。

我們對解決方案進行比較,結果如下:

動態 | Layer2 項目Matic短時暴跌 70% 項目方近期將1.6億代幣轉出基金會:幣安Launchpad項目Matic Network于12月10日早上發生異常下跌,在8點30-9點30分之間,其代幣從0.04美元暴跌至0.015美元,跌幅超過 70%。在此之前,Matic基金會合約地址曾大量轉出代幣,根據Etherscan數據查看,項目方在最近30天內一共從基金會合約內轉出了1.6億枚 MATIC代幣,其中部分代幣充入了幣安交易平臺。[2019/12/10]

Rollup機制目前被普遍認為是最有前景的擴容方式,在兩種主流的Rollup方案中,最核心的問題便是如何驗證Rollup交易中的真實性。

OptimisticRollups和ZKRollups運用了不同的思維邏輯,前者樂觀地相信交易的真實性,而后者悲觀地不相信,因此生成零知識證明來自證清白。

相比之下,兩者的優劣如下:

OptimisticRollup的優勢是能夠更好地支持EVM合約,劣勢在于驗證效率低,安全性較低;

ZkRollup的優勢在于高度去中心化,驗證效率高,劣勢在于生成零知識證明并打包的過程非常復雜,較難兼容EVM,也較難落地。

下面主要對OptimisticRollup的兩大方案Optimism和Arbitrum進行介紹。

Optimism和Arbitrum

首先我們來看看OptimisticRollup方案的流程:

Optimism和Arbitrum在基本流程上跟上述描述一樣,直截了當來說:Optimism的爭議解決方案比Arbitrum更依賴于以太坊虛擬機(EVM)。當有人提交關于Optimism的挑戰時,存在問題的交易都會通過EVM再運行一遍。

相比之下,Arbitrum使用鏈下爭議解決流程將爭議二分減少到一筆交易中的一個步驟。然后,協議將這個一步的斷言發送到EVM進行最終驗證。

因此,從概念上講,Optimism的爭議解決過程比Arbitrum簡單得多。但Arbitrum大大減少了鏈上的驗證壓力。

Arbitrum的整體架構如下所示:

由于Arbitrum是針對以太坊的擴容方案,因此Arbitrum架構自然部分存在于Layer1上,部分存在于Layer2上;

存在于Layer1上的Arbitrum組件為EthBridge,它是一組以太坊合約;

EthBridge負責仲裁ArbitrumRollup協議,以及維護鏈的inbox和outbox;

鏈的inbox和outbox允許用戶、Layer1合約和完整節點將他們的交易發送到鏈并觀察這些交易的結果;

Arbitrum虛擬機是Layer1和Layer2之間的網關,這也由EthBridge產生;

AVM能夠讀取輸入,并對這些輸入執行計算以產生輸出;

ArbOS運行在Arbitrum虛擬機之上,負責保證Arbitrum鏈上智能合約的執行;

ArbOS完全存在于Layer2上,并像在以太坊上運行一樣運行EVM合約。

Arbitrum的爭議解決過程主要依賴鏈下的遞歸二分算法。該算法通過不斷二分差異點來迫使”斷言者“和”挑戰者“縮小分歧,最終在Layer1上解決分歧。解決的具體方案如下所示:

而Optimism則直接讓EVM執行整個交易,因此它只需要一輪交互即可完成。出于這個原因,OptimismRollup通常被稱為“單輪”,而ArbitrumRollup是“多輪”。兩者最大的區別在于:Arbitrum解決爭議時間長,因此確認時間較長。Optimism需要執行整個交易,Gas費更高。

Eigen——Layer2Rollup的隱私計算方案

對于隱私計算而言,通常結果是樂觀主義的。在隱私計算領域,一筆交易極其復雜,在Layer1執行完這筆交易非常困難,因此,Arbitrum是隱私計算領域中較優的選擇,這也是Eigen基于Arbitrum進行開發的原因。

EigenRollup是一套EVM兼容、支持樂觀執行和可驗證性聲明的混合Rollup方案。

樂觀執行:類似于CPU的分支預測(BranchPrediction),交易會被預執行,驗證者驗證交易的合法性;通過挑戰協議對有爭議的交易進行裁決;

可驗證性聲明:采用TEE簽名和零知識證明技術對計算過程的正確性和結果完整性提供非交互式證明。

EigenRollup基于Arbitrum提供如下技術:

隱私可驗證性證明:EigenRollup在Arbitrum的交互式證明方案的基礎上,采用TEE進行關鍵隱私操作指令的執行,從而降低交互式證明消耗,提供交互式證明的隱私保護;

公平定序器:現有的定序器存在中心化程度太高,以及跟驗證節點聯合作惡的風險。EigenRollup采用一種公平算法來實現定序器,實現了低手續費的同時,也防止了MEV等攻擊的可能性。

分布式任務執行引擎:EGVM作為隱私合約的執行虛擬機,支持分布式任務管理。EGVM會將分布式任務調度到EigenCC計算集群進行并行計算,并且生成對應的可驗證證明。

Tags:ROLLROLARBArbitrumroll幣是什么意思ROL價格Arbitrage Tokenarbitrum幣價格

比特幣交易所
NFT:為什么頭像能夠主導NFT市場熱潮?-ODAILY

區塊鏈收藏品有多種風格,但其中一種顯然是領先的。CoinMarketCap的數據顯示,在市值排名前十的NFT系列中,有七款可以被稱為“頭像NFT”——基本上是卡通人物或像素化人物的頭像.

1900/1/1 0:00:00
區塊鏈:區塊鏈之符號理論:抽象化和身份管理的必要條件-ODAILY

數字技術之所以有用,在很大程度上是因為它們通過抽象化對象的復雜屬性來創造表征,然后使用這些新形成的身份來控制和管理實體.

1900/1/1 0:00:00
CHA:Chainlink在智能合約中的77種應用方式(一)-ODAILY

本文是“Chainlink在智能合約中的77種應用方式”的第一篇文章,旨在介紹智能合約通過Chainlink連接鏈下數據,激活了去中心化金融應用場景.

1900/1/1 0:00:00
ADA:Footprint:Abracadabra將使用什么魔法追趕MakerDao?-ODAILY

撰文:Footprint分析師Simon(simon@footprint.network) 日期:2021年11月 數據來源:FootprintAbracadabraDashboard全球疫情的.

1900/1/1 0:00:00
BCA:田曉磊:二進制體系的新人類? 后人類時代最具哲思性的“造物者”-ODAILY

“這是你最后的機會,一旦做出,再無回頭之路。吞下藍色藥丸,一切就此結束,你在自己的床上醒來,繼續相信你愿意相信的一切。吞下紅色藥丸,你將留在仙境,我會讓你看看兔子洞究竟有多深.

1900/1/1 0:00:00
NFT:回顧2021,每一天都是刷新認知的一天-ODAILY

區塊鏈是數字時代的最新產物,在過去的短短幾年間經歷了飛速發展和多次更迭:從2017年的萌芽、2018年智能合約、2019年更迭,到2020年DeFi,在2021年.

1900/1/1 0:00:00
ads